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
617 4038948838 40429327989
308763 5490667 023969654
308763 5490667 023969654
9137 9344598323 074253574
All about undefined
Interested in learning more?
308763 5490667 023969654
9137 9344598323 074253574
See more
80 920168541
4634059 5066 87 48829907
See more
61060266686 2027769
35515278 852 2891 0865 68015610
See more